| Summary of the main achievements of the charity, identifying the difference the charity’s work has made to the circumstances of its benefciaries and any wider benefts to society as a whole. |
Para 1.20 | The Charity recognised that the outbreak of Covid and subsequent Government restrictions made it difficult for the Charity to fulfill a number of activities normally associated with the Church Year. We consider most of what we do to be for the benefit of the community in which we serve, and for providing the provision of a meeting place and worship services, contributing to the spiritual and moral education of children and to carry out, as a practical expression of our beliefs, other activities providing a place for young and old to meet. This has been greatly curtailed during Covid nevertheless we have made use of Social media and Zoom to maintain our contact in particular Sunday Worship/ Friday prayer group, and online House Groups In addition the Charity recognised that Covid placed hardship issues for some within the Community and reached out to provide both financial, practical and moral support. |
